Bus from Toronto to Vancouver

Toronto
Vancouver, Canada

Your cost to travel by Line 5601 bus, bus, line 5407 bus: $382 - $466

Toronto, ON
  • Total Distance:

    734.08 km (456 miles)

  • Travel Time:

    11 Hours 11 Minutes

  • Frequency:

    2 Times/Day

  • Bus Fare:

    70.0 USD (~73.85 CAD)

Sault Ste Marie, ON
  • Total Distance:

    1480.82 km (920 miles)

  • Travel Time:

    20 Hours 32 Minutes

  • Frequency:

    0 Times/Day

  • Bus Fare:

    130.0 USD (~137.15 CAD)

Winnipeg, MB
  • Total Distance:

    151.66 km (94 miles)

  • Travel Time:

    1 Hours 56 Minutes

  • Frequency:

    1 Times/Day

  • Bus Fare:

    27.0 USD (~28.48 CAD)

Sidney Jct, MB
  • Total Distance:

    1296.18 km (805 miles)

  • Travel Time:

    19 Hours 54 Minutes

  • Frequency:

    1 Times/Day

  • Bus Fare:

    120.0 USD (~126.6 CAD)

Calgary, AB
  • Total Distance:

    1042.28 km (648 miles)

  • Travel Time:

    15 Hours 27 Minutes

  • Frequency:

    3 Times/Day

  • Bus Fare:

    75.0 USD (~79.12 CAD)

Vancouver
Source: Rome2rio

Bus schedule

Departure Arrival Bus Fare Operator Duration
Toronto, ON Sault Ste Marie, ON 70 USD https://www.greyhound.ca 10h 45mins
Sault Ste Marie, ON Winnipeg, MB 130 USD https://www.greyhound.ca 19h 45mins
Winnipeg, MB Sidney Jct, MB 27 USD https://www.greyhound.ca 1h 52mins
Sidney Jct, MB Calgary, AB 120 USD https://www.greyhound.ca 19h 8mins
Calgary, AB Vancouver, BC 75 USD https://www.greyhound.ca 14h 51mins

Cost by number of pax.

Pax Currency (USD) Currency (Local)
1 person 445 USD ~ 469 CAD
2 people 890 USD ~ 939 CAD
3 people 1,335 USD ~ 1,408 CAD
4 people 1,780 USD ~ 1,878 CAD
5 people 2,225 USD ~ 2,347 CAD

Did you know?

  • The total CO2 Emission for your Toronto - Vancouver bus trip is 141.15 kg
  • Your total cost to travel by bus from Toronto to Vancouver is about 445.0 USD (~469.47 CAD)